Police, Inland Community Harvest Sweet Potatoes in Keerom Papua

In a bid to boost the local economy, Keerom Sub-district police, Keerom regency administration and a local farmer group, harvested sweet potato in Baburia Village on Tuesday (26/9/2023). "We hope that the harvested sweet potatoes can improve the economy of the Abua Rakat Farmer Group, their families, and the community in Baburia Village, Keerom Regency," said Chief Brigadier Batias Yikwa,  a member of Keerom Sub-Regional Police Public Safety and Order Unit, known as Bhabinkamtibmas,. The sweet potato harvesting activity was attended by  local officials and the Abua Rakat Farmer Group, which was supported financially by the Keerom Regency administration to operate a designated farming spot to sustain their agricultural activities. Keerom Sub-regional Police distributed fertilizer and essential food items, including rice, directly to the leader of the Abua Rakat Farmer Group, as a sign of support. Yikwa expressed gratitude for the sweet potato harvest, which he attributed to the hard work and dedication of the Farmer Group. He emphasized that the harvested sweet potatoes would contribute to the economic well-being of the group, their families, and the wider community in Baburia Village, Keerom Regency. (mg/fa/pr/nm)
